The Hidden Problem: Traditional Scheduling Is Costing You Money
Many contractors assume every customer call is equal—but that’s a big mistake. Not every job brings the same value, and spending time on low-value calls, price shoppers, and non-loyal customers is draining your resources.
Another costly error? Giving out pricing over the phone. The moment you do, you risk losing the job to a competitor offering a lower bid. Instead, you need a system to filter out low-value calls and focus on customers who are ready to invest in your services.
The Solution: A Smarter, More Profitable Scheduling Strategy
Instead of scheduling calls in the order they come in, prioritize them based on business impact using these key factors:
✅ Loyal Customers & Membership Holders – These customers already trust you and are more likely to invest in additional services. They should always come first.
✅ High-Value Jobs – Prioritize big-ticket services that boost your bottom line instead of filling your schedule with small, low-profit repairs.
✅ New Customers in High-Value Neighborhoods – First-time customers in prime areas present future revenue opportunities. Get your team out there.
✅ Urgency & Service Need – Emergency jobs should take priority over non-urgent requests to keep your team efficient.
✅ Potential Long-Term Clients – Some customers are serious about building a relationship with your business, while others just want the cheapest deal. Prioritize the ones that matter.
🚫 Low-Priority Calls: Price Shoppers & Quote Seekers – If someone is just calling for a quick price check, don’t let them take up valuable time and resources.
